Application Fee
The application charge is normally paid at the local chauffeur's license authority when submitting your application. This fee covers processing your application and is an obligatory expenditure.
Vision and Health Tests
Before getting a chauffeur's license, candidates must pass both a vision and health test. The expenses typically vary from EUR6 to EUR10 for the vision test, while health-related problems might require extra documents that can sustain extra fees.
Emergency Treatment Course
An emergency treatment course is needed for all new chauffeurs. The expense for this differs from EUR30 to EUR50, depending on the organization offering the course.
Theoretical Test Fee
The theoretical test, which covers the guidelines of the road and driving policies, expenses between EUR20 and EUR30. Passing this test is mandatory before carrying on to practical driving lessons.
Driving Lessons
Practical driving lessons are a significant expense when requesting a chauffeur's license. The expense ranges from EUR50 to EUR100 per lesson, and applicants usually need about 10 to 20 lessons before taking the dry run.
Dry Run Fee
After finishing the required lessons, candidates must pay a fee of approximately EUR150 to EUR250 to take the practical driving test. This fee can vary depending on the screening area and examiners' rates.
